What problem does it solve?

This Skill provides a governance escalation tier for making strategic decisions and handling complex deliberations by assembling a dynamic board of experts, running a structured 5-phase decision process, and producing auditable governance artifacts.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Dynamic Board Composition: Assembles a board from a pool of 53 agents based on the topic.
  • Structured Decision Process: Runs a 5-phase process (assess, discuss, vote, resolve, persist) for decision-making.
  • Auditable Artifacts: Generates auditable governance artifacts for accountability.
  • Use Case: When considering a major architectural change, this Skill can assemble a board of experts, facilitate a structured discussion, and make a binding decision with auditable documentation.

Quick Start

Run the legion board review <topic> command to initiate a board meeting for the given topic.
